Kalki 2898 AD, Jawan, Animal: Crossover films are scripting a new language for Indian cinema

With film industries globally struggling to get people to theatres post pandemic, Indian cinema is carrying out an interesting experiment—the crossover collab.

A new cinematic language is taking shape in India, powered by crossovers. Since its inception, Indian cinema was locked in linguistic silos—Bollywood, Tollywood, Kollywood, Mollywood and the many smaller woods that exist in a country where the local language changes every 20 kilometres. With film industries across the world struggling to get people to theatres after the pandemic, Indian cinema is carrying out an interesting experiment—the crossover collaboration.

Moving across industries

These crossovers, unlike superhero crossovers in the Marvel Universe, are seeing actors and directors move across industries. In recent years, several filmmakers based in the south of India have ventured into making films in Hindi

Take popular titles like Jersey, and —all these films have been made by successful filmmakers from down south. Actors from southern film industries have also moved into Hindi films. and are all examples of actors crossing over from south cinema to Hindi. On the other hand, Bollywood stars are also venturing into films beyond Hindi. Sanjay Dutt and Raveena Tandon made a conspicuous showing in while Ajay Devgn and Alia Bhatt made their presence felt in . Deepika Padukone and Amitabh Bachchan stole the spotlight in .

World Emoji Day special| Varun Sharma: Emojis are a language in themselves

Varun Sharma made moviegoers fall in love with his character Choocha from the Fukrey franchise owing to his funny expressions. So, on World Emoji Day today, he emotes his funniest expressions as he shoots for us

He adds, “If you have an argument with someone, you know the replies are cold when they put the slightly smiling face emoji. Toh aapko pata chal jaata hai ki banda chidh gaya hai. I use a lot of heart emojis. I have certain friends who only talk through emojis – 60% text mein aur 40% emojis! It’s a great secret language.”

The 34-year-old, who was recently seen in the film Wild Wild Punjab, says besides the heart emoji, he also uses the rolling eyes emoji quite frequently.

But his mother’s favourite is “the namaste and hug wala”. Sharma adds, “Like every family, we, too, have a family WhatsApp group, where I message when my flight is about to take off or when I land. The folded hands emoji and the hug emoji from her mean a lot to me.”
